3
Q

Elongation

A

UDPglu give glu to primer of glycogen or glycogenin protein with oligosach chain of 7 glu . Glycogen synthase enzyme play role.

4
Q

Branching

A

When gluc chain becomes of 11-12 then 5-6 gluc chain breaks and attaches over the left chain as a branch . Branching enzyme plays role .

7
Q

Debranching enzyme and process

A

Debranching enzyme have two roles first of transferase second of glucosidase
On formation of dextrin that is one glu molecules having two branches of 4 glu attached to it transferase play role in transferring the branch to the straight chain leaving only one glu at branch the long chain and glucosidase break the alpha-1,6-glycosidic bond .

9
Q

Regulation by hormones

A

Glucagon -> cAMP -> protein kinase -> phosphorylase kinase -> phosphorylation of glycogen synthase(inactivation) & phosphorylation of glycogen phosphorylase (activation)
Insulin take up cAMP so no phosphorylation

12
Q

Disorders of glycogen storage

A

Versatile- von gierkes - glu6phosphatase
Player - pompes’ - acid maltase lysosomal
Cory - cori - debranching enzyme
Anderson’s - anderson - branching enzyme
Made -mcardles - muscle phosphorylase
History- her’s- liver phosphorylase enzyme
